Alocasia for sure, sorry I do not have outdoor pics with more erect growth but in just like an Alocasia Mac but with purple stems. It got to about 8 ft tall before flowering. I gave the Mother plant to Andrew in Holland and I hope he still has it . I gave Bamboo Mark in the UK one but he killed it. I originally got my plant from Simon of Amulree Exotics (Turn it Tropical) in the UK . It had come as a mislabelled plant to Simon and I was very new to Exotic plants so had no idea of a name for it, nor did Simon or Paul Spracklin who was with me that day could put a name to it. I grow Xanthoma's so I know for sure it's not one, I wish I could grow a Xanthoma that big in France , perhaps here in the US I can :-)
